Army-organised Kashmiruk Fankaar Season III in Bandipora promotes Kashmiri culture, art and tradition Anchor:-The Indian Army on Friday concluded Kashmiruk Fankaar Season III in Bandipora, highlighting Kashmiri culture, art and traditional practices through a series of youth-centric cultural and sports activities held over three weeks. The grand finale was held in N.M Higher secondary school Bandipora town and witnessed participation from hundreds of local artists and youth from across North Kashmir. The initiative aims to preserve and promote Kashmir’s rich cultural heritage while providing a platform for artists and performers, particularly during the winter months when cultural activities remain limited. An artist who participated in the event said the initiative goes beyond performance opportunities. “This platform has not only provided space for artists to perform but has also helped promote and preserve Kashmiri art, culture and traditions. It has attracted a large number of young people who actively participated and showed interest in cultural activities,” she said. Major General Tushar Sharma, VSM, General Officer Commanding (GOC) Kilo Force, attended the event as the chief guest. Deputy Commissioner Bandipora Indu Kanwal Chib and Senior Superintendent of Police Ajaz Zargar were also present, along with senior Army officers and local civil administration officials. Launched in 2023, Kashmiruk Fankaar has steadily expanded in scale and participation, emerging as a key platform for showcasing traditional and contemporary Kashmiri art forms. Army officials said the programme was designed to engage youth positively while strengthening the bond between the Army and the local population. Season III was conducted in three phases. The first phase focused on sports and physical activities to promote discipline and teamwork. The second phase centred on social awareness and responsible citizenship. The final phase featured cultural competitions including singing, dancing, painting and traditional Kangri-making, reflecting Kashmir’s artistic and cultural traditions. Sabkat, a local athlete who participated in the sports segment, said such initiatives play a key role in youth development. “These programmes motivate young people towards physical fitness and also create awareness about drug abuse, which has affected and devastated many lives,” she said. The programme concluded with a prize distribution ceremony, reaffirming the Army’s commitment to promoting cultural preservation, youth engagement and social awareness in North Kashmir.
